Just brought my 306 few days ago and an airbag light has lit up on the speedo. Anyone know what this could be??


RE: Airbag light!! - 306Dan - 09-11-2013

Normally the pretensioner connections under the seats they can get loose due to stuff been rammed under the seats


RE: Airbag light!! - cully - 10-11-2013

as dan said unless you have turned the key to disable the passenger airbag

RE: Airbag light!! - Zeuse47 - 24-02-2014

Just fixed it today I had the same problem airbag switch for passenger side was on but the airbag light just stayed on constantly all the time so,

We removed the wires from under the passenger seat and cut all the plugs, Re-soldered them back together, Did the same with the loom under the drivers side seat but that didn't fix it.

FIX:
We took out the central column (The whole thing) and underneath where the front ash tray is there's another loom for the airbags and pretension's there's also an ECU unit for the airbag just above that is the loom, We un-plugged all of them, Plugged em back in and it was gone no more air bag light. Result Smile

Did all of this without removing the battery.
